L&T secures multiple EPC orders for piped water supply scheme in Madhya Pradesh
The water and effluent treatment business of Larsen & Toubro has secured multiple EPC orders for the execution of rural piped water supply schemes in various districts of Madhya Pradesh.
The projects are part of Jal Jeevan Mission and cover the districts of Guna, Ashoknagar, Shivpuri, Agar Malwa & Singrauli, said a press release.
The scope includes design and construction of intake structures, water treatment plants of aggregate capacity 377 MLD, transmission and distribution pipelines of length 17,513 km, 23 master balancing reservoirs of aggregate capacity 17.5 ML, 1313 overhead service reservoirs of aggregate capacity 193 ML, 46 nos. of sump and pumphouse of aggregate capacity 46 ML, 6.5 lakh house service connections and associated electromechanical and instrumentation works including 10 years of operation and maintenance.
The project also involves automation and measurement of water quantity and quality through SCADA system.
The schemes will cater to the drinking water requirement of 3,103 villages covering a population of 48 lakh. The projects are part of the Government’s plan to provide piped water supply to every rural household by 2024.
The business has also secured an order to execute Integrated Infrastructure development works at Gwalior. The project envisages development of 800 acres of Maharajbada region in Gwalior with 16 km of smart roads, 5 acres of urban parks, 31 km of storm water drains, multilevel underground car parking and underground power distribution system.
